this post was submitted on 01 Jul 2024
536 points (93.8% liked)

Technology

59705 readers
5308 users here now

This is a most excellent place for technology news and articles.


Our Rules


  1. Follow the lemmy.world rules.
  2. Only tech related content.
  3. Be excellent to each another!
  4. Mod approved content bots can post up to 10 articles per day.
  5. Threads asking for personal tech support may be deleted.
  6. Politics threads may be removed.
  7. No memes allowed as posts, OK to post as comments.
  8. Only approved bots from the list below, to ask if your bot can be added please contact us.
  9. Check for duplicates before posting, duplicates may be removed

Approved Bots


founded 1 year 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
[–] asdfasdfasdf 38 points 5 months ago (4 children)

C++

If they're starting a browser from scratch, why would they not have chosen Rust? Seems very short sighted to not have learned from Firefox.

[–] [email protected] 70 points 5 months ago (1 children)

They used c++ initially since it was spawned from SerenityOS, which was designed to be a mashup of win2000 and unix.

now that Ladybird is its own project, it's not constrained to that goal, and they have said they will incorporate modern languages.

[–] asdfasdfasdf 11 points 5 months ago

Glad to hear that!

[–] [email protected] 14 points 5 months ago (2 children)
[–] asdfasdfasdf 9 points 5 months ago

Yes, that's what I'm referring to. They could build on that, or they could write something their own in Rust. But I'd think building on Servo would be fantastic.

[–] [email protected] 7 points 5 months ago* (last edited 5 months ago)

I know about servo. It was pretty much a dead project until they joined the Linux fondation last year and started getting some sponsorship. Since then, they being doing pretty good on there own with personal donations rising by around 20% each month, reaching more than 2000$ monthly. Wish them all the best!

[–] maxinstuff 13 points 5 months ago (1 children)

Must be planning on actually shipping something

/s

[–] asdfasdfasdf 10 points 5 months ago (1 children)

Ship what, segfaults / invalid memory access? Lol

[–] [email protected] 14 points 5 months ago